describer:一个简单的python模块,帮助在arcpy中使用Describe函数

时间:2024-07-26 02:52:13
【文件属性】:

文件名称:describer:一个简单的python模块,帮助在arcpy中使用Describe函数

文件大小:10KB

文件格式:ZIP

更新时间:2024-07-26 02:52:13

Python

描述者 描述器试图通过根据输入数据类型显示您有权访问的所有有效属性,使函数更加用户友好。 例如,描述地理数据库要素类意味着您可以访问。 您还可以使用可用的等。 这意味着您必须导航多个资源页面以确定哪些属性可用于任何给定的输入。 描述器使用 hasattr(object, name) python 内置函数来查找给定描述对象的所有有效属性。 这个技巧已经在 ArcGIS 文档中暗示过: 如果您尝试访问 Describe 对象不具有的属性,它将抛出错误或返回空值(无、0 或 -1 或空字符串)。 如果您不确定某个特定属性,可以使用 Python 的hasattr()函数进行检查。 Describer 还会为您进行描述,因此在将输入输入到类中之前无需使用 arcpy 来描述输入。 例子 import describer desc = ' \\ Example.gdb' D = desc


【文件预览】:
describer-master
----.gitattributes(483B)
----LICENSE(1KB)
----describer()
--------properties_all.json(6KB)
--------__init__.py(2KB)
----README.md(4KB)
----.gitignore(625B)
----scraper()
--------properties_all.json(6KB)
--------property_scrape.py(1KB)
--------describe_urls.json(8KB)
----example.py(383B)

网友评论